Download as PDF 226.100 Powers of county police in enforcing chapter. Enforcement of the provisions of this chapter shall be within the jurisdiction of the fiscal court of any county except that county police shall not exercise authority within the corporate limits of a city of ten thousand or more population. County police for the purpose of locating stolen goods, may carry out the provisions of KRS 226.060 in a city of any size or in the county area of their jurisdiction. History: Created 1972 Ky. Acts ch. 237, sec. 5.
